10 Garage Security Tips to Protect Your Home

Your garage is more than just a place to park your car—it’s an entry point to your home and a valuable storage space. Unfortunately, it’s also a common target for burglars. Strengthening garage security is essential for protecting your property and ensuring your family’s safety. Here are 10 essential garage security tips to keep your home secure.


1. Upgrade to a Roll-Up Garage Door

Traditional garage doors with segmented panels can be pried open, making them vulnerable to break-ins. A roll-up garage door offers a more secure alternative, with a solid steel or aluminum curtain that fits snugly against the frame, reducing access points for intruders.

2. Install a High-Quality Locking System

Standard garage door locks can be easy to bypass. Consider installing:

  • Deadbolt locks for added reinforcement
  • Side-mounted slide locks that prevent the door from being lifted
  • Smart locks that integrate with home security systems for remote control

3. Secure Garage Windows

Windows in your garage provide an easy way for burglars to see inside. Improve security by:

  • Adding frosted or tinted film to obscure visibility
  • Installing security bars or reinforced glass
  • Using window locks to prevent forced entry

4. Install Motion-Activated Lighting

Bright lights act as a strong deterrent for potential intruders. Place motion-activated LED lights around your garage entrance and driveway to eliminate dark areas where burglars could hide.

5. Reinforce the Garage Entry Door

The door leading from your garage into your home should be just as secure as your front door. Enhance security by:

  • Using a solid-core door that resists forced entry
  • Installing a deadbolt lock
  • Adding a peephole or smart doorbell camera

6. Never Leave the Garage Door Open Unattended

An open garage door provides easy access for thieves. If you frequently forget to close it, consider:

  • Installing a garage door timer that automatically closes after a set period
  • Using a smart garage door opener that allows remote monitoring and control

7. Keep Valuables Out of Sight

Avoid leaving expensive tools, bicycles, or other valuable items visible. Store them in locked cabinets, overhead storage racks, or concealed areas to minimize temptation.

8. Disable the Emergency Release Cord

Burglars can manipulate the emergency release mechanism from outside using a coat hanger. Prevent this by:

  • Securing the release cord with a zip tie
  • Installing a garage shield to block access to the release lever

9. Integrate Your Garage with a Home Security System

Connecting your garage to a monitored home security system adds an extra layer of protection. Look for features like:

  • Security cameras with live monitoring
  • Smart garage door sensors that send alerts if the door is opened unexpectedly
  • 24/7 professional monitoring for immediate response to security breaches

10. Lock Your Garage When You’re Away

If you’re going on vacation or leaving for an extended period, take extra precautions:

  • Disconnect the garage door opener to prevent remote hacking
  • Use a manual lock or padlock on the door track
  • Ask a trusted neighbor to keep an eye on your property
